Github包含README.md中的md文件?

时间:2016-01-29 08:41:18

标签: github markdown readme

Github中是否有办法将md文件包含在例如README.md中?

# Headline

Text

[include](File:load_another_md_file_here.md)

它不应链接到文件,它应该从中加载内容,如PHP include / file_get_contents。

4 个答案:

答案 0 :(得分:19)

这似乎不太可能,尤其是在考虑github/markup#346github/markup#172时。

不支持include指令。

答案 1 :(得分:4)

这不是正确的答案,而是对其他真正想要这个的人的解决方法。

在将文件发送到Github之前,可以使用GulpGulp Concat将文件合并为一个文件。

答案 2 :(得分:1)

Ruby gem markdown_helper implements include files for GitHub flavored markdown (GFM).

Disclosure: I wrote the gem.

答案 3 :(得分:0)

因为不可能,所以我最终将链接放置为

#include <iostream>

#define NIL 0
#define MAX 1000

long int lookup_table[MAX] = {};

using namespace std;

long int fib(int n) {
    if(n <= 1)
        return n;
    return fib(n-1) + fib(n-2);
}

long int fib_mem(int n) {
    assert(n < MAX);
    if(lookup_table[n] == NIL) {
        if(n <= 1)
            lookup_table[n] = n;
        else
            lookup_table[n] = fib_mem(n-1) + fib_mem(n-2);
    }
    return lookup_table[n];
}

int main() {
    int n;
    long int fibonnaci, fibonacci_mem;
    cout << " n = "; cin >> n;

    // naive solution
    fibonnaci = fib(n);

    // memoized solution
    // initialize();
    fibonacci_mem = fib_mem(n);

    cout << fibonnaci << endl << fibonacci_mem << endl;

    return 0;
}